
Valeria Villa received the Outstanding Student Presentation Award from the 2021 AGU Fall Meeting held in New Orleans, LA, December 13-17, 2021. The title of the study is "3D Basin Depth Map for the San Gabriel, Chino, and San Bernardino Basins".
The Outstanding Student Presentation Awards (OSPAs) promote, recognize and reward undergraduate, Master's and PhD students for quality research in the Earth and space sciences. It is a great honor for young scientists at the beginning of their careers. The process relies entirely on volunteer judges. Typically the top 3-5% of presenters in each Section are awarded an OSPA and all judged students are provided feedback.
